Simply Desserts is a little bakery with an important lemon blueberry cake. It’s acceptable to buy it whole and tell everyone it’s for a friend’s birthday, but then drive home like a maniac and chip away at it every few hours with a plastic spork. We fully endorse eating it for dinner, and then again for breakfast, because blueberries are healthy.
